The President General of Ohanaeze Ndigbo, Chief Emmanuel Iwuanyanwu, has passed away.

His son, Jide Iwuanyanwu, confirmed the news.

In a statement, Jide mentioned that the 82-year-old Iwuanyanwu died on Thursday after a brief illness.

“The Iwuanyanwu family of Umuohii Atta, in Ikeduru Local Government Area of Imo State, announces the demise of our patriarch, Engr Chief Emmanuel Chukwuemeka Iwuanyanwu-Ahaejiagamba Ndigbo,” the statement read.

“Chief Iwuanyanwu died on Thursday, July 25, 2024, after a brief illness. He was aged 82. Chief Iwuanyanwu before his death was President General of Ohanaeze Ndigbo worldwide and President of Owerri Peoples Assembly.”

Iwuanyanwu is survived by his wife, Lady Princess Frances Iwuanyanwu, numerous children, and grandchildren.

The family announced that burial details would be provided later after proper consultations.

Born on September 4, 1942, to Pa Bernard Iwuanyanwu and Madam Hulder Iwuanyanwu of Umuohii Atta in the Ikeduru Local Government Area of Imo State, he was a prominent Nigerian politician and businessman, known as one of the wealthiest Igbo men in the country.

Iwuanyanwu became the 11th President-General of the Igbo socio-cultural organization on April 20, 2023, succeeding George Obiozor, who led Ohanaeze Ndigbo for two years before passing away on December 29, 2022.
